Position Summary:

The Senior Programmer, Pharmacometrics plays a key role in the Clinical Pharmacology department and is responsible for programming of quantitative analyses in support of internal decision-making and regulatory submissions. This position works closely with the Clinical Pharmacology and pharmacometrics program leads as well as cross-functional team members and external partners to deliver success across all phases of development. Quality control and efficiency are essential. This is a remote (US) based position.

Essential Job Functions and Responsibilities:

These may include but are not limited to:

  • Produce real-time analyses to support ongoing study decision-making (interim analyses, Safety Review Committee, etc.)

  • Provide exploratory data analyses to support modeling and simulation

  • Understand data via graphical and tabular summaries

  • Run innovative analyses to help understand potential modeling approaches

  • Develop processes for effective figures and data visualizations

  • Build out internal capabilities for data visualizations

  • Develop process to generate iterative interim figures for rapid interpretation.

  • Deliver final high-quality outputs for submissions, presentations, and publications.

  • Create dynamic and/or interactive displays to inform and influence stakeholders.

  • Create analysis-ready datasets for NCA, population PK, PK/PD, and exposure-response analyses.

  • Build analysis datasets from CDISC or interim sources.

  • Conduct data cleaning and develop QC processes.

  • Deliver specifications and define documentation.

Education and Experience:

  • Bachelor's or Master's in a relevant scientific field with 5+ years of experience programming in the pharmaceutical industry. Direct pharmacometrics-related programming experience is a major advantage.

  • Substantial experience creating analysis-ready modeling datasets for NONMEM and/or Phoenix NLME.

  • Understanding of SDTM and ADaM datasets including ADNCA and ADPPK

  • Experience with validation of R, SAS, or other software is desired.

  • Must possess graphical programming skills.

  • Clinical drug development and clinical pharmacology knowledge desired.

  • Ability to work cross-functionally with data managers, programmers, statisticians, and external partners.

  • Strong written, presentation and verbal communication skills.

  • Expertise in R programming required, SAS programming skills desired. Windows, MS Office (Outlook, Word, Excel, PowerPoint), GraphPad Prism.
